Chasing the Milky Falls: Dudhsagar Trek Adventures Await
Hidden deep within the lush forests of the Western Ghats, Dudhsagar Falls—literally translating to “Sea of Milk”—is one of India’s most enchanting natural wonders. Cascading from a height of over 310 meters, it is among the tallest waterfalls in the country and sits on the Goa–Karnataka border. The Dudhsagar Trek offers more than just a visual treat; it’s an immersive adventure that combines hiking through dense forests, crossing streams, and walking alongside a historic railway track with the roar of the falls guiding your way.

Explore the Untamed Beauty of Jhalana Leopard Safari
Nestled in the heart of Jaipur, Rajasthan, the Jhalana Leopard Safari offers a unique blend of wilderness and accessibility. Known as India’s first leopard reserve located within a city, Jhalana has emerged as a hidden gem for wildlife enthusiasts, photographers, and eco-tourists. With its growing popularity and increased leopard sightings, this reserve showcases the thriving biodiversity that exists just beyond the bustling city limits.

Wilderness Beckons: Your Ultimate Guide to Kudremukh Trek
Deep in the heart of the Western Ghats, where mist rolls over emerald hills and rivers weave through dense rainforests, lies Kudremukh — a paradise for nature lovers and trekkers alike. Located in the Chikkamagaluru district of Karnataka, this enchanting peak, whose name translates to "horse face" in Kannada due to its distinctive shape, is one of India’s most captivating trekking destinations. The Kudremukh Trek promises not only breathtaking landscapes but also a deeper connection with nature, making it a must-explore trail for anyone seeking solace away from city life.
